Symphogen is in an exciting phase as the Antibody Center of Excellence in Servier with a continued focus on the development of antibody-based therapeutic products for the treatment of cancer and inflammatory/autoimmune diseases.

Symphogen is now looking for a Team Manager Stability & Formulation in Drug Product Development to participate in an exciting journey and expand an increasingly diverse portfolio. The drug product development department is anchored in the CMC Biologics function and is responsible for developing the biologics portfolio from early to late stages.

With direct report to Director Drug Product Development, you will have a dual role, partly as manager of a team in the department and partly with a scientific role as a drug product scientist in the development projects:

As Manager, you will be responsible for the scientific deliverables within the team of 6 scientists and the day-to-day activities. You will set the direction for the team by supporting the growth and development of each team member and contributing to the development of strategies and processes within drug product development.

As Scientist, you will be a valuable member of the development projects or strategic initiatives. You will be involved in drug product development and be responsible for, e.g., formulation development, design of stability studies, overseeing outsourced manufacturing, compatibility studies during early-stage and late-stage development and documentation preparation for authorities.

You will collaborate closely with colleagues from the CMC Biologics group and be a member of cross-functional project teams that will drive the project’s progression together.

Your qualifications include a minimum of five years of experience in drug product development for biopharmaceuticals and a strong foundation in stability and/or formulation or manufacturing. You should have experience with GMP and regulatory requirements associated with biologics drug  development and familiarity with ADCs and combination products. Additionally, you may benefit from experience in people management and leadership (direct or indirect).

You have a Master’s Degree such as a cand.pharm., cand.scient., cand.polyp., or equivalent, and you have strong English skills, verbally and in writing. 

As a person, you are independent and proactive, excelling as a collaborative team player who adopts a diplomatic and cooperative approach when working with global cross-functional teams. Moreover, you are committed to professional excellence and quality, upholding high personal integrity in a complex environment.

Symphogen is a subsidiary of Servier and antibody center of excellence primarily focused on oncology and immune oncology. We have a highly efficient antibody discovery and research platform supported by comprehensive early development capabilities.

Our antibody platform delivers antibodies with unique functionalities providing best or first in class potential as combination or mono therapy. Our approach and capabilities are well suited for combination therapies at the core of future cancer treatment.

Symphogen is located in Ballerup in the greater Copenhagen area. The company currently employs approximately 150 people
